How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Henderson Mill?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Henderson Mill Studio Apartments | $1,518 | $975 | $2,054 |
Henderson Mill 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,516 | $887 | $5,380 |
Henderson Mill 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,816 | $1,100 | $7,038 |
Henderson Mill 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,133 | $1,376 | $3,943 |
Henderson Mill 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,510 | $2,260 | $2,785 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Henderson Mill
How much are Studio apartments in Henderson Mill?
There are currently 13 Studio Apartments in Henderson Mill with rent ranges from $975 to $2,054 with an average price of $1,518.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Henderson Mill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Henderson Mill ranges from $887 to $5,380 with an average monthly rent of $1,516.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Henderson Mill c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Henderson Mill range from $1,100 to $7,038.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,816.
How expensive are Henderson Mill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 37 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Henderson Mill on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,376 to $3,943 - averaging $2,133 for the location.
